Output 85f876403aa80b58737e5938cd7e137f05d23bff6291eb47be03caf7dff0203a:1
- value
- 21421658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8deb1505fb266d636812aa7f2f3ba2d10ae44c78 OP_EQUAL
- address
- 3EdQpPEFWdoJjajc4PNRjEnEDcASBEKSwG
- transaction
- 85f876403aa80b58737e5938cd7e137f05d23bff6291eb47be03caf7dff0203a